Despite the robust growth drivers, the Flame Retardant Polyester Fiber market faces several significant restraints that could impede its full potential. A primary concern revolves around the high production costs associated with specialized flame retardant chemicals and the complex manufacturing processes required to embed these properties into polyester fibers. This often translates into higher end-product prices, which can limit adoption in price-sensitive market segments. Furthermore, environmental and health concerns surrounding certain conventional flame retardant chemicals, particularly halogenated compounds, are leading to increased scrutiny and regulatory restrictions, necessitating costly research and development into safer alternatives. The volatility of raw material prices, including petroleum-derived polyester precursors and various flame retardant additives, introduces supply chain uncertainties and impacts profitability. Lastly, the availability and improving performance of alternative fire-resistant materials, such as aramid fibers or modified natural fibers, pose competitive challenges to the market.

Flame Retardant Polyester Fiber refers to synthetic fibers made from polyester that have been specially treated or engineered to resist ignition and slow down flame spread. This fire-resistant property is achieved either by incorporating flame retardant chemicals during the fiber manufacturing process (permanent/intrinsic) or by applying post-treatments to conventional polyester fabrics.
Flame Retardant Polyester Fibers are widely used across various industries where fire safety is paramount. Key applications include home textiles (e.g., curtains, upholstery), apparel (e.g., workwear, protective clothing), automotive interiors, building and construction materials, aerospace components, and specialized industrial fabrics. Their use helps meet stringent fire safety regulations and enhance safety in diverse environments.
